., tax lien) is sold at auction, are charged 18% per annum.197.432 Sale of tax certificates for unpaid taxes.(6) Each certificate shall be awarded to the person who will pay the taxes, interest, costs, and charges and will demand the lowest rate of interest, not in excess of the maximum rate of interest allowed by this chapter. [...]Translation: Florida is a bid-down interest rate state.
